Athens council advances several grants and programs: AEDC guideline readings, TxDOT RAMP grant, tourism and public funding allocations

City Council of the City of Athens, Texas · September 8, 2025

Council heard first readings for Athens Economic Development Corporation grant guidelines and approved the TxDOT RAMP grant plus tourism and public funding allocations totaling $177,000 recommended across programs.

At its Sept. 8 session the Athens City Council considered multiple resolutions related to economic development and grants. Several AEDC programs were presented on first reading while other grant allocations and a TxDOT RAMP grant were approved by unanimous vote.

Donna Meredith, Community Development Manager, presented the AEDC Business Assistance Grant Guidelines (first reading), which staff described as a program to provide physical improvements to new or existing businesses within the Athens city limits with a maximum grant amount of $20,000 per applicant; the AEDC resolution would authorize an expenditure of $100,000 for FY2026 if adopted on subsequent reading.
